Excerpt from Paraboles de Sendabar sur les Ruses des Femmes: Traduites de l'Hébreu Et Précédées d'une Notice Historique sur ce Sage Indien
Voilà donc une traduction arabe du livre de Calila et Dimna échappée aux recherches de M. Silvestre de Sacy traduction qui ne fut pas faite d'après la version pehlvitique mais directement d'aprés l'original sanscrit.
Cette traduction arabe de Jacob fils de Schears, paraît être, au reste, postérieure à la version arabe d'abd-allah fils d'almo cañ'a; elle est peut-être celle qui a servi de texte àla version hébraïque.

Paperback. Zustand: New. Print on Demand. This book uncovers the fascinating interplay between Jewish, Persian, Arabic, and Greek cultures through the lens of a medieval Hebrew manuscript. The author takes readers on a journey to explore the transmission of the Indian Panchatantra, a collection of animal fables with moral lessons. Through the analysis of the Hebrew translation and its relation to earlier Arabic and Greek versions, the author traces the evolution of these tales as they traveled across continents and centuries. The book sheds light on the significant role Jewish scholars played in the dissemination of knowledge and cross-cultural exchange during the Middle Ages, and highlights the enduring power of storytelling as a means of conveying wisdom across diverse societies.
